Amazon SageMaker: The Hub for Machine Learning

Amazon SageMaker is an integrated development environment that simplifies the process of building, training, and deploying machine learning models. It offers a range of tools that cover the entire machine learning lifecycle, making it easier for developers and data scientists to work with AI.

Key Features:

  • Built-in Algorithms: SageMaker provides a variety of pre-built algorithms that can be used for different types of machine learning tasks. These algorithms are optimized for performance and can save time and resources.
  • Jupyter Notebooks: Integrated Jupyter notebooks allow for easy experimentation and prototyping. These notebooks are hosted and managed directly within SageMaker, facilitating a streamlined workflow.
  • AutoML: SageMaker Autopilot automatically prepares data and selects the best algorithms for your model, making it easier for users with limited machine learning experience to create high-quality models.
  • Model Deployment: Once a model is trained, SageMaker provides easy options for deployment, including real-time endpoints and batch processing.

By using SageMaker, you can quickly turn your machine learning ideas into reality, taking advantage of its scalability and integration with other AWS services.

Amazon Rekognition: Analyzing Visual Content

Amazon Rekognition is a powerful image and video analysis service that can identify objects, people, text, and activities within visual media. It also offers facial recognition capabilities that can be used for security and customer engagement purposes.

Key Features:

  • Object and Scene Detection: Rekognition can identify objects and scenes in images, making it useful for categorizing content or enhancing search functionality.
  • Facial Analysis: This feature allows you to detect and analyze facial attributes, including emotions, age ranges, and gender. It can be used for personalized customer experiences or security applications.
  • Celebrity Recognition: Rekognition can identify well-known personalities in images and videos, which can be useful for media companies and entertainment industries.
  • Text in Images: The ability to detect and extract text from images can be leveraged for document scanning and data extraction tasks.

By integrating Rekognition into your applications, you can gain valuable insights from visual content and enhance user interactions.

Amazon Comprehend: Natural Language Processing Made Simple

Amazon Comprehend is a natural language processing (NLP) service that helps you understand and analyze textual data. It uses machine learning models to extract insights and detect patterns in text, enabling you to perform tasks such as sentiment analysis and entity recognition.

Key Features:

  • Sentiment Analysis: Comprehend can determine the sentiment behind a piece of text, whether it is positive, negative, neutral, or mixed. This can be useful for monitoring customer feedback or brand perception.
  • Entity Recognition: The service can identify and categorize entities such as people, organizations, and locations within text, which is valuable for data extraction and information retrieval.
  • Language Detection: Comprehend can automatically detect the language of a given text, supporting multiple languages and enhancing multilingual support in applications.
  • Topic Modeling: The service can analyze large volumes of text to identify common themes or topics, providing valuable insights into trends and user interests.

Amazon Comprehend enables you to unlock actionable insights from your textual data, improving decision-making and enhancing customer experiences.

Amazon Lex: Building Conversational Interfaces

Amazon Lex is a service that allows you to create conversational interfaces using voice and text. It powers chatbots and virtual assistants, making it easier for users to interact with applications through natural language.

Key Features:

  • Speech Recognition: Lex can convert speech into text, enabling voice-based interactions and making applications more accessible.
  • Natural Language Understanding: The service uses NLP to understand and interpret user inputs, providing accurate and contextually relevant responses.
  • Integration with AWS Lambda: Lex can be integrated with AWS Lambda to perform backend tasks based on user interactions, such as retrieving data or executing business logic.
  • Multi-Language Support: Lex supports multiple languages, allowing you to create chatbots that can interact with users around the world.

By using Amazon Lex, you can create intelligent and interactive conversational interfaces that enhance user engagement and streamline customer service processes.

Amazon Polly: Converting Text to Speech

Amazon Polly is a text-to-speech service that converts written text into lifelike speech. It supports a variety of languages and voices, making it possible to create natural-sounding audio content for applications, services, and devices.

Key Features:

  • Lifelike Voices: Polly offers a range of high-quality voices that sound natural and expressive, improving the user experience in applications that require spoken content.
  • Custom Pronunciation: The service allows you to customize pronunciations and speech patterns, ensuring that the generated speech aligns with specific requirements or preferences.
  • Speech Marks: Polly can generate speech marks that provide information about the timing and structure of the spoken content, which can be useful for applications requiring synchronized audio and visual elements.
  • Neural Text-to-Speech: The neural text-to-speech technology used by Polly delivers more natural and human-like speech, enhancing the quality of audio content.

Amazon Polly can be used to add voice capabilities to a wide range of applications, from interactive voice response systems to multimedia content.

Amazon Translate: Breaking Language Barriers

Amazon Translate is a neural machine translation service that enables you to translate text between different languages. It supports multiple languages and is designed to deliver high-quality translations that maintain the context and meaning of the original content.

Key Features:

  • Real-Time Translation: Translate can provide instant translations, making it ideal for applications that require on-the-fly language conversion.
  • Context-Aware Translations: The service uses advanced machine learning models to deliver translations that are contextually accurate, reducing the likelihood of errors or misunderstandings.
  • Custom Terminology: Translate allows you to create custom terminology and translations specific to your business or industry, ensuring consistency and accuracy in specialized content.
  • Integration with Other AWS Services: The service can be easily integrated with other AWS services, such as Amazon S3 or AWS Lambda, to streamline translation workflows and automate processes.

By leveraging Amazon Translate, you can make your content accessible to a global audience and enhance communication across different languages.

Amazon Textract: Extracting Data from Documents

Amazon Textract is a service designed to extract text and data from scanned documents and images. It goes beyond traditional Optical Character Recognition (OCR) by analyzing the structure and layout of documents to provide more accurate and useful data.

Key Features:

  • Form Data Extraction: Textract can identify and extract key-value pairs from forms, making it easier to process and organize structured data.
  • Table Extraction: The service can extract tabular data from documents, preserving the structure and relationships between different data elements.
  • Text and Document Analysis: Textract analyzes the layout and content of documents to extract text, tables, and forms with high accuracy.
  • Integration with AWS Services: The extracted data can be integrated with other AWS services, such as Amazon Comprehend or Amazon S3, for further processing and analysis.

Amazon Textract simplifies the process of data extraction from documents, enabling automation and reducing manual effort in data entry tasks.

Amazon Kendra: Intelligent Search for Your Data

Amazon Kendra is an intelligent search service powered by machine learning. It provides highly accurate search capabilities that can be integrated into applications and websites, helping users find relevant information quickly and efficiently.

Key Features:

  • Natural Language Queries: Kendra understands natural language queries, allowing users to search for information using conversational language rather than specific keywords.
  • Contextual Search: The service uses machine learning to provide contextually relevant search results, improving the accuracy and relevance of search queries.
  • Integration with Multiple Data Sources: Kendra can index and search data from various sources, including databases, file systems, and content management systems.
  • Custom Ranking and Relevance: The service allows you to customize search ranking and relevance settings to align with your specific needs and preferences.

By incorporating Amazon Kendra into your applications, you can provide users with powerful search capabilities that enhance their ability to find and access information.
